What i am seeing is MakerDAO becoming one of the most recognized RWA projects in the industry. They are diversifying their portfolio with real world assets and have already invested in few projects that are trying to connect real world assets with the crypto industry by tokenizing them.
That's good if they're doing that actually. Investors are investing into a project that they can see what it has projected and it's happening in real life. If they are distributing like this and buying real world assets, that's just necessary for them if they have been into this niche as a project. Tokenizing assets and backing it up with the real one is a strong contender on this market where investors will find it interesting to get in.

MakerDAO is a veteran in the crypto industry and they have an experienced team. It will be wise to track what they are doing in terms of development.
